The Lady Outlaw - Jessica James has been on stage most of her life. She signed a movie contract with MGM when she was seven years old. That lasted until she was married at seventeen. Jessica devoted herself to her family taking a break only to perform in the Student Prince in Heidelberg, Germany in 1972. Jessica returned to the United States in 1973. She toured with her own band throughout the United States and Europe for the next two years, including performances in England and on the BroadLand Radio Network. She appeared on the Grand Old Opry four times and opened shows for almost all of the country stars including George Jones, Faron Young, Alabama, Dottie West and Minnie Pearl.

Jessica released her first album in 1975. Later that year she joined the staff of radio station WFNL in Augusta, Georgia as an announcer, beginning a radio career that lasted twenty-five years. It’s been a lifetime of ’firsts’ for Jessica. She was the first female radio personality in Augusta, Georgia; Orlando, Florida; Knoxville, Tennessee and Springfield, Missouri – where she became known as The Lady Outlaw. Jessica was the first of only five women ever to be listed in the Who’s Who of Country Music Performers and Radio Personalities. In 1994 Jessica hosted Branson Backstage, a weekly TV production and interviewed every resident star in Branson as well as most of the guest stars to visit Branson during that season.

In 1997 she left broadcasting to, once again, perform on stage as a cast member of the Greg Thompson production, The Golden Girls Stand Up and Salute! That year the revue played to standing-room-only crowds in Branson and in Laughlin, Nevada. In 1998 it was the same in Biloxi, Mississippi and – once again – in Branson. In I999 Jessica hosted Greg Thompson Productions’ Great American Game Show at The Grand Casino in Gulfport, Mississippi and at the Seven Feathers Casino in Canyonville, Oregon. Jessica’s singing talents include country and pop... a variety of 40’s and 50’s Big Band Music... and Gospel as well. She has performed on stage with Wayne Newton and Tony Orlando and has performed as the opening act for virtually every major country star performing today.
